east-west path between paddies, road
陌 centers on a path or road, specifically an east-west path between rice paddies, extending to any road or way.
陌 combines ⻖ (mound, earth) with 百, which likely contributes the sound. The character originally referred to a raised path between fields, especially an east-west one.
The left side ⻖ suggests an earthen mound or raised path, and the right side 百 (hundred) can be imagined as many rice paddies. Picture a raised east-west path running between a hundred rice fields.
For ハク, imagine walking along the path and hearing the sound of a hawk overhead: hawk -> ハク, as you follow the east-west road between the paddies.
